NetXMS Support Forum

Russian Support => Общие вопросы => Topic started by: Dmitry on January 21, 2011, 04:08:04 PM

Title: Проблема мониторинга squid
Post by: Dmitry on January 21, 2011, 04:08:04 PM
Коллеги,

Очередная проблема. Пытаюсь мониторить squid. NetXMS-агента на сервер не ставил. Squid скомпилирован с поддержкой SNMP. Слушает на порту 3401.
Команда snmpwalk -v 2c -c NetXMS 10.1.10.10:3401 .1.3.6.1.4.1.3495.1.1 выдает вот такой ответ:
SNMPv2-SMI::enterprises.3495.1.1.1.0 = INTEGER: 1136
SNMPv2-SMI::enterprises.3495.1.1.2.0 = INTEGER: 92720
SNMPv2-SMI::enterprises.3495.1.1.3.0 = Timeticks: (2436) 0:00:24.36


Однако NetXMS отказывается опознавать хост как имеющий SNMP-агента. При этом, запрос SNMP к сквиду приходит, но некорректный. Сквид выдает вот это: Failed SNMP agent query from : 10.1.10.23.

Может, сталкивался кто?

Update: еще интереснее:

$ nxsnmpwalk -c NetXMS -p 3401 -v 2c 10.1.10.10 .1.3.6.1.4.1.3495.1.1
.1.3.6.1.4.1.3495.1.1.1.0 [02]: 8224
.1.3.6.1.4.1.3495.1.1.2.0 [02]: 92460
.1.3.6.1.4.1.3495.1.1.3.0 [43]: 60621


Еще udpate: если этой ноде добавить SNMPшный DCI, то он отрабатывает. Однако SNMP walk через SNMP browser не работает.
И опять update: SNMPшный DCI отрабатывает только если у DCI проставить значение Use custom SNMP port в значение 3401. Не смотря на то, что у хоста прописан этот SNMP-порт.